About Us
Oxfordshire Community Foundation was set up in 1995 and is part of a rapidly growing network of 56 Community Foundations which has been active in the UK since the 1980's.
To date Oxfordshire Community Foundation:
-
has given out grants totalling over £2½ million
-
has helped over 750 organisations
-
made more than 1,000 grants
-
has endowment funds of £1.3 million.
-
has managed and distributed over £1.5 million of statutory funds.
Our Mission Statement:
We are committed to improving the quality of life of the people of Oxfordshire by raising and managing funds for distribution in response to local needs.
The Foundation is a member of and accredited to the national Community Foundation Network.
By March 2007 UK Community Foundations collectively held over £150 million in endowment (funds for the future) and a year ago made grants of over £70 million.
